HZ Construction is honored for Black History Month

ORLANDO, Fla. — HZ Construction is a family-owned and operated construction company that received acknowledgment from Valley Bank for its long-standing contributions to the Central Florida community.

President Anderson C. Hill, II, and his spouse of 47 years, Sandra Myers Hill, have dedicated over four decades to the region. The Hill’s notable contributions include leading the construction of the Amway Center, now referred to as the Kia Center and building approximately 30 schools in Orange County.

“This honor by Valley Bank is not just a celebration of our achievements but a testament to the hard work, dedication, and resilience of everyone at HZ Construction. We are humbled and motivated to continue our mission of uplifting individuals and transforming communities for the betterment of all Central Florida residents,” said Sandra Myers Hill, co-founder of HZ Construction.

The Hills have persistently given back to the community, supporting local initiatives and creating opportunities for others.
